Weekend Rail News - Ipswich Town News
Fans travelling in from London will have to add at least an extra ninety minutes to their journey with Railtrack closing two of the four lines for the duration of the weekend. As well as delays many trains will be cancelled on both Anglia Railways and First Great Eastern.
